How many ethnic minorities are there in Guangdong?

There are 56 ethnic groups in Guangdong, and the ethnic minorities living in the world are Zhuang, Yao, She, Hui and Manchu.

Zhuang people are mainly distributed in Lianshan, Huaiji, Lianjiang, Xinyi, Huazhou and Luoding.

Yao people are mainly distributed in Liannan, Lianshan, Lianzhou, Yangshan, Yingde, Ruyuan, Lechang, Renhua, Qujiang, Shixing, Wengyuan, Longmen and Yangchun counties (autonomous counties, cities and districts).

She nationality is mainly distributed in Ruyuan, Nanxiong, Shixing, Zengcheng, Heping, Li Anping, Longchuan, Dongyuan, Fengshun, Raoping, Chaoan, Haifeng, Huidong and Boluo counties (autonomous counties, cities and districts).

Hui people are mainly distributed in Guangzhou, Shenzhen, Zhuhai, Zhaoqing, Shantou, Foshan, Dongguan and other cities.

Manchu is mainly distributed in Guangzhou.

Since the reform and opening up, the floating population of ethnic minorities (non-registered population) who have moved into or temporarily stayed in Guangdong because of talent flow, marriage, work and business are mainly concentrated in cities in the Pearl River Delta region such as Guangzhou, Shenzhen, Zhuhai, Foshan, Dongguan, Zhongshan and Shunde.
